To inform a candidate they have been shortlisted, send a concise and positive message: "Dear [Candidate Name], we are pleased to inform you that you have been shortlisted for the [Job Title] position. We will reach out shortly with further details regarding the next steps."
FAQs & Answers
- What should I include in a notification to shortlisted candidates? Include a positive note, mention the job title, and inform them of the next steps in the hiring process.
- How soon should I contact shortlisted candidates? It’s best to reach out within a few days after the shortlist is created to keep candidates engaged.
- Can I send a shortlist notification via email? Yes, sending an email is a common and efficient method to inform candidates they’ve been shortlisted.
- What tone should I use when notifying candidates? Use a friendly and professional tone. The message should be concise but encourage enthusiasm about the next steps.
